Summary/Abstract: The law finds its full validity and applicability in times of crisis or extreme stress because at such times the temptation to justify the use of certain means, which we normally condemn, is at the highest rates. The International humanitarian law has been adopted and assimilated in order to limit the violence inherent in any armed conflict. It does not prohibit war, it implies it and attempts as much as possible to limit its disastrous consequences.
